AEW Rampage Viewership Down For February 4 Episode

AEW Rampage Viewership Down For February 4 Episode

The viewership figures and demo rating for Friday’s (February 4) edition of AEW Rampage on TNT have now been revealed.

Per Brandon Thruston of Wrestlenomics, Friday’s show drew 540,000 viewers. This is down from the January 28 edition, which drew 601,000 viewers.

In the key 18-49 demographic, last week’s episode scored 0.20 rating. This is down from the 0.25 rating that the week prior received.

The show was headlined by Ricky Starks defeating Jay Lethal to retain the FTW Championship. It also featured Sammy Guevara beating Isiah Kassidy for the TNT Title and Adam Cole defeating Evil Uno.

It’s worth mentioning that the show did face competition from coverage of the ongoing Winter Olympics.
